Reines Du Sabbat is a 1995 PC-9800 RPG by Kenix Soft that follows Puff, a girl searching a forest for a rare herb to save her dying brother. What starts as a straightforward quest quickly spirals into a grim tale of survival and human darkness. The game mixes turn-based combat with exploration, though its real focus is on a story that prioritizes shock over subtlety. Gameplay is straightforward but dated, with visuals and mechanics typical of early 90s PC titles. This title gained a notorious reputation in Japan for its graphic content and disturbing themes, leading to underground circulation on freeware sites. While not widely discussed outside niche circles, it remains a curiosity for fans of obscure RPG history. With a runtime of around 10-15 hours, it’s a brief but intense experience. Community mentions often reference its abrupt tonal shifts and unflinching brutality, cementing its status as a bizarre footnote in Kenix Soft’s career before Corpse Party.
